Step-By-Step-Guide On How To Check Your EPF Claim Status

EPF (Employees' Provident Fund), or PF (Procident Fund) is a government-sponsored savings plan for organized-sector employees. EPFO offers a variety of services through the government's unified mobile app, Umang. The Google Play Store/App Store is where you can get the app.

Both the employee and the employer contribute to the employee's EPF account on a regular basis under the PF plan. Employees should contribute at least 12% of their base wage as a minimum contribution. The employer is also required to contribute the same amount, i.e. 12% of the employee's basic wage.

EPFO offers employees to check the status of their claim with the PF after they seek to withdraw their EPF funds. This service is available to Employees' Provident Fund members, subscribers, and pensioners who have filed a claim at any EPFO office around the nation. This feature allows you to keep track of the status of a claim you've submitted.

Check your EPF claim status via various channels with these step-by-step instructions:

Check your EPF claim status via UAN Portal:

  • Visit the UAN Member portal and log on with your UAN and Password.
  • Click on the 'Online Services' tab and a drop-down will appear.
  • Click on the third option- 'Track Claim Status.
  • On the screen, you'll see the progress of your online withdrawal/transfer claim.

Check EPF claim status without UAN:

  • Visit the official site of EPFO.
  • Then go to the 'Know your Claim Status' section.
  • Now select the 'Click Here for Knowing the Claim Status' option.
  • Select your PF Office State and city from the drop-down menu.
  • Then enter your PF number and click on 'Submit'.
  • The status of your claim will now show on the screen of your device.

Check your EPF claim status Via the EPFO website:

  • Visit the official EPFO portal at epfindia.gov.in.
  • Now find the 'For Employees' option under the tab 'Services'.
  • Click on the 'Know Your Claim Status' option under the heading 'Services' on the page.
  • The EPFO portal will then show you the button 'Click here to get redirected to the passbook application'. https://passbook.epfindia.gov.in/MemberPassBook/Login
  • Now enter your UAN and password to access your account and complete the captcha.
  • The option to 'View Claim Status' will now appear. To check the status of your EPF claim, select that option.

Check your EPF claim status via SMS

If a mobile number has been linked to the account, the EPFO also sends SMS alerts. Employees can verify the progress of their claim by sending an SMS to 7738299899 from their registered mobile number. 'EPFOHO UAN LAN' must be the SMS format. The 'LAN' in this format refers to the language code in which you wish to receive the information. The table below shows the various languages and their codes.

The facility is available in 10 languages.

LANGUAGES SUPPORTED

  1. English - Default
  2. Hindi - HIN
  3. Punjabi - PUN
  4. Gujarati - GUJ
  5. Marathi - MAR
  6. Kannada - KAN
  7. Telugu - TEL
  8. Tamil - TAM
  9. Malayalam - MAL
  10. Bengali - BEN
